What are microalgae?
- Primary source of oxygen in all aquatic systems including the oceans.
- Autotrophic microbes that can capture carbon from air and water, to convert into renewable algal biomass.
- Most nutrient-rich whole-food with high levels of proteins, antioxidant pigments and heart-healthy fatty acids.

How does algae-based wastewater treatment work
- It’s a process that utilizes the ability of microalgae to simultaneously utilize sunlight and pollutants to generate renewable biomass, pure oxygen and clean water.
